Pastoral (liturgy)
The Pastorale is a handbook for diaconal workers and clergy that is used in practical pastoral care . The pastoral contains small devotions , short liturgies , prayers , intercessions , Bible words and blessings for different situations. It is used in the evangelical church . In the Catholic Church the equivalent Pastorale roughly the Benedictional .
History and meaning
The Evangelical Pastorale was reissued for the first time by the Lutheran Liturgical Conference in 1981 and has since appeared in many editions. It fulfills its task at the interface between pastoral care, diakonia and liturgy. The Evangelical Pastoral is described in the foreword as “a handout for pastoral care” and contains biblical calls to prayer and words of comfort. The pastoral helps pastoral workers in the encounter with old, sick, dying and grieving people. Instructions and formulations for emergency baptism , the evening meal and prayer in the mourning house support pastoral or diaconal action. Pastoral support for meeting people who have had an accident gives orientation in difficult situations. Ecumenism
In the Catholic Church , the official liturgical book that specifically contains rites of blessing is called Benediction . The Orthodox Church , the Roman Catholic Church and the Protestant Churches have now published a joint book that comes close to the objective concern of the Protestant pastoral . It is the ecumenical prayer book You in our midst . There you will find interdenominational prayers on the subject of “praying with the dying” and other texts that are explicitly ecumenical and taken from the broad field of ecumenical Christianity.
